    The Stamford Fire Department is pleased to announce our new 2016 KME Severe Service 1500 GPM Pumper Engine has been placed into service today as Engine 9.  Engine 9 is stationed at the Turn of River Fire Station #2 (on Roxbury Road).   It has a 1000 gallon water tank and a 30 gallon foam tank.     On September 3rd, 2016, Engine Co. #6 was dispatched, along with a paramedic ambulance from Stamford EMS, to a residence on Glenbrook Road for a report of an 86-year-old male who was unconscious and not breathing.     Robert Michael Callahan, 89, passed away peacefully with his children by his side on October 19, 2016 at St. Peter's Hospital in Albany, NY.
